What is a calendar worksheet?
A calendar worksheet is a worksheet that allows your child to fill in the day and date. This worksheet calendar also includes a place to color or circle the weather and some St. Patrick’s Day images to color.
How to use a calendar worksheet
Using this calendar worksheet is easy, fun, and beneficial for your child. They can fill in a new copy each day or you can make the page reusable. Your child can find and circle the day of the week, the day’s weather, and the date. There is space for them to write the numeral for the day’s date, if they’re writing numbers. Your child can also color the clipart and color, trace, or rainbow write “March.” If your child is still working on writing numbers, be sure to grab these free printable number tracing sheets.
